CO1224T Carbon Monoxide Detector

Alarm TestWill send alarm signal to panel
Hush/SilenceIf required, the audible alarm can be silenced
for 5 minutes by pushing the button marked “Test/Hush”. The red alarm light
will continue to flash in temp-4 pattern. If carbon monoxide is still present
after the 5 minute hush period, the audible alarm will sound. The hush facility
will not operate at levels above 350 ppm (parts per million) carbon monoxide.
RealTestWhen testing with real CO it will auto silence after about 20 second
It will reset after all the CO has cleared from the sensor
Trouble When the sensor supervision is in a trouble condition (such
as a sensor that has been tampered with), the detector will send a trouble signal
to the panel. The detector must then be replaced. There is no local audible
signal when detector is in trouble.
End Of LifeWhen the detector has reached the end of its life,
the trouble contact will open. This indicates that the CO sensor inside the detector
has passed the end of its life and must be replaced. This detector’s lifespan
is approximately six years from the date of manufacture. There is no local
audible signal when detector is in trouble. Periodically check the “Replace by”
sticker located under the detector cover. The detector must be replaced by this date.
